

Welcome to Tring Yoga Studio, a down-to-earth studio dedicated to bringing the benefits of yoga to the local community and beyond. Founded in April 2016, Tring Yoga Studio takes a unique approach to fitness, offering a wide range of classes including the gravity-defying freedom of Aerial Yoga. This practise involves performing yoga and pilates-inspired exercises while hanging from fabric hammocks suspended about a metre above the ground.

One of the highlights at Tring Yoga Studio is the Aerial Yoga class, which offers numerous benefits. Practising Aerial Yoga forces almost every part of the body to move and stretch, toning, strengthening, and rehabilitating muscles and joints. This unique practise provides a diverse and effective workout that is both challenging and enjoyable.
